About Dr. Casey Weinstein

Dr. Weinstein seeks to create a safe and confidential environment that encourages open exploration.  She uses a variety of techniques in her approach to psychotherapy, tailoring her approach based on each individuals needs.

Casey Weinstein is a licensed Marriage and Family therapist. Dr. Weinstein received her Doctorate in Psychology with an emphasis in Marriage and Family Therapy from the The Chicago School of Professional Psychology and her Bachelors degree in Child and Family Services from Syracuse University.  She received training and supervision at the nationally-recognized Maple Counseling Center in Beverly Hills, California.  Throughout her time at The Maple Center she worked in the Adult program as well as the Child and Adolescent Program.  

Through the Child and Adolescent program, she has spent several years providing psychotherapy to children and teens in schools throughout Los Angeles.  Her work in schools has enabled her to have a unique perspective and has allowed her to foster relationships with schools to benefit her clients.

Dr. Casey Weinstein is a certified facilitator in leading Reflective Parenting Groups through the Center for Reflective Parenting in Los Angeles, CA.  She runs 10- week workshops that help provide tools and hands on strategies for parents as they navigate their role in their child and adolescents lives.
